Hey, Washington, Stop Bunching Up Your Panties! China’s A Paper Tiger

China’s shock currency devaluation last week begs the following questions: Is China a rising giant of the twenty-first century poised to overtake the United States in wealth and military prowess? Or is it a house of cards preparing to implode? Conventional wisdom espouses the former. Yet, hard evidence suggests the latter.

China: Paper Tiger